Cult of domesticity |
Movement that urged women to stay at home |
|
Reform societies |
Groups that organized to promote changes to society |
|
Catherine Beecher |
Educator who worked to establish schools for women |
|
Lucretia Mott |
Prominent abolitionist who helped organize the Seneca falls convention |
|
Elizabeth Cady Stanton |
Organizer of the Seneca falls convention |
|
Seneca falls convention |
First women's rights convention held in the United States |
|
Free blacks |
African Americans who were not enslaved |
|
Nat turner |
Leader of the deadliest slave revolt in American history |
|
Underground Railroad |
An informal, constantly changing network of escape routes for slaves |
|
Harriet Tubman |
Escaped Slave who became the most famous worker on the Underground Railroad |
|
Abolition movement |
Campaign to abolish or end slavery |
|
William Lloyd Garrison |
Leading spokesperson for the abolition movement |
|
Frederick Douglass |
Escaped Slave who became a prominent abolitionist |
